Why a Similar Product May Not Be an Equivalent Product
Consumers are frequently advised to buy a local alternative when a requested European product is unavailable. In some situations, this is practical. However, two products in the same category are not automatically interchangeable.
Products can differ in active ingredients, concentration, fragrance, texture, application method, packaging system, or suitability for a particular routine. Even when the names and visual presentation appear similar, the intended use may not be identical.
This distinction is particularly important for people who have already used a product successfully. They may not want to repeat the process of testing alternatives, especially when their skin, hair, preferences, or established routine responds well to a specific version.
The Main Reasons Consumers Request Specific European Products
1. The Product Is Not Available Locally
The most direct reason is a genuine availability gap. A manufacturer may sell a product in Germany or another European market without appointing a distributor in the consumer’s country. Local shops may carry the brand but not the requested product line, shade, size, or variation.
2. The Regional Version Is Different
Brands sometimes adapt product names, formulas, instructions, sizes, or packaging for different markets. A consumer who wants the European-market version may therefore search using a photograph, barcode, exact size, or complete product name rather than the brand name alone.
3. The Consumer Has Used the Product Before
Previous positive experience creates a clear reason to request the same product again. The consumer may have purchased it while visiting Europe, received it from a family member, or used it before moving to another country.
4. Local Distribution Has Ended
A product may previously have been available locally but disappear because a retailer changed its assortment, a distributor ended cooperation, or the brand revised its regional strategy. The same item may still remain available through established retail channels in Germany.
5. A Specific Size or Format Is Needed
Consumers may seek a travel size, refill, professional format, fragrance-free variation, limited edition, bundle, or larger package that is not offered in their country. The difference may concern convenience or intended use rather than the core product itself.
6. The Available Sellers Are Difficult to Verify
A product may appear on international marketplaces, but the consumer may be unable to verify the seller, source market, storage history, or exact product version. This can motivate a request through a business that provides clearer sourcing and shipping information.

Why Exact Product Identification Matters
Product identification is one of the most important parts of a responsible request process. A short or translated product name may refer to several versions. Packaging photographs can also become outdated after a redesign.
Useful identification information can include the full product name, brand, size, barcode, intended use, packaging photograph, preferred version, and country where the product was previously purchased.
This information reduces the risk of sourcing a similar but incorrect item. It also helps determine whether the requested version is still sold, has been reformulated, or has been replaced by a newer product.
Why Verified Sourcing Is Especially Important
Limited availability can push consumers toward unknown marketplace sellers or listings with incomplete information. A low price or matching photograph does not by itself confirm the seller’s identity, the product’s origin, or whether the listing represents the exact requested version.

Limitations Consumers Should Understand
Submitting a product request does not mean the requested item will automatically become available. Stock levels can change quickly, and some products may be discontinued, restricted, temperature-sensitive, pressurized, flammable, or otherwise unsuitable for international transport.
Customs duties, import taxes, local product rules, and carrier restrictions may also apply. These conditions depend on the product and destination and cannot be assumed to be identical for every order.
Consumers should also avoid treating sourcing verification as a promise of individual suitability. An authentic product can still cause irritation, conflict with personal preferences, or be unsuitable for a particular health condition. Product directions, warnings, and ingredient information should always be reviewed.
